本教程理论结合实际,从企业与市场、财务金融、企业管理等多个角度选择案例,编制情景,设计课内外语言活动,以帮助工商管理英语学习者充分利用语境,通过大量实训,逐步提高工商管理中的英语口头、笔头交际能力和技巧。本教程内容可操作性强,有较高的实践价值,理论上紧扣专业基础知识,并做到语言简洁、思路清晰;案例选择上注重工商管理情景的真实性和趣味性;实训操练上强调实用性、互动性和新颖性。
本教程分为四大模块(模块一:商务基本理念;模块二:市场与营销;模块三:财务金融;模块四:商务管理),共16个单元。每一单元都包含理论简介、两个实践案例和补充阅读三个部分。
本教程可作为高等院校学生专门用途英语教程,也可用作相关职业培训专用教材。
